Stage by stage comments

Stage 1

New bread and butter 13-point damage combo shaved off a lot of time (punch, punch, knee, knee, elbow) = (2 dmg, 2 dmg, 2 dmg, 2 dmg, 5 dmg) = 13

Stage 2

Very minor cleanups from previous run. Discovered Y-offset of 90 or 91 is the key to getting enemies to fall off stage. The boss is on a global timer after the first round of enemies dies - so there's no point in killing the two whip girls any faster, the boss will still come out at exact same time.

Stage 3

Sacrificed style for speed in Double Bolo fight
Found a new out of bounds area for Green Bolo fight! There is a cliff in the bottom right hand corner

Stage 4

Hot Potato time with dynamite. Figured out how to gather weapons and bundle Bolos together and kill everyone at same time. Intentionally take damage to keep enemies right over the dynamite (glancing blows can do less damage)
Cleaner path up to boss on ledge with less movement
Found a little fun with garbage memory after the enemies clear out of boss area (you can make them drop whips and boxes too). The only common theme I see from what shows up is - it could be unfreed memory from enemies that are thrown off ledges

feos: As was said in the thread(s), Easy is the fastest difficulty for this game, and the harder ones are only harder due to enemies' HP. 2-player run would lag lake crazy, even this one does. What looks unreasonable in this run is in fact either lag reduction or enemy manipulation.

Thank you! Re: the two adobos I used dynamite on - I can align myself on same Y-offset to throw enemies into the pit. The problem is the game glitch won't work here. It's unreachable by the Adobos. The enemies will simply get stuck in place - right out of range, and will never come down. I did manage to throw one of the Adobo's off the left hand side of that area once (not using the glitch... just managing to get them into the lower part of that bridge area) - but I can't get both over here - one of them always gets stuck.

There's 4 levels of difficulty: Easy, Medium, Hard, Extra Hard. Enemies gain an extra 4 HP per difficulty level. For example: Stage 1 Adobo has 34 HP on Easy, 38 HP Medium, 42 HP on Hard, 46 HP on Extra Hard. Player health does not change between difficulty levels (you always have 53 HP) The AI difficulty doesn't seem to change much between levels - if at all. From memory - the enemy counts don't change either (I rarely play on Hard and Extra Hard - with the health amounts - it's a boring grind) If you're interested in a full breakdown of every enemy's health on all 4 stages: please take a look at this Google Spreadsheet: https://docs.google.com/spreadsheets/d/1rrCgVNUCvbQ-CbDxKYcOKLS3B7h4YxN6liTRHngzw10/edit#gid=0 Fun Fact: Stage 4 Jeff (the Green Palette swap of Billy and Jimmy) is actually the highest HP character on game, not Willy - the final boss

Unfortunately I'm not sure how much [more] can be done about lag caused by sprites. This game is infamous for being a laggy P.O.S., and it kicks in as soon as there's 3+ sprites on screen (and trying to fight 1 on 1 makes for a slow stage completion) If you'll notice, I do manage minor lag caused by aux. objects like weapons (boxes, boulders, whips, etc). I'm either throwing them off screen, or making sure they fall into pits/cliffs once I've used them as much as I need to. For example, in my previous TAS when I dropped the Lindas off ledge in Stage 2 Boss Area, their whips fell onto elevator platform - which left them on screen at start of Stage 3 - and caused a little lag. For this run, I elbow them in opposite direction to keep the whips off screen at start of Stage 3
